import { randomBytes } from 'node:crypto'; import { eq, and, isNull, sql, gt } from 'drizzle-orm'; import z from 'zod'; import { Database } from '../db/index.js'; import { Examples } from '../examples.js'; import { fn } from '../fn.js'; import { PairingCodeTable } from './pairing-code.sql.js'; function generateCode(): string { const chars = 'ABCDEFGHJKLMNPQRSTUVWXYZ23456789'; let code = ''; const bytes = randomBytes(4); for (let i = 0; i < 4; i++) { code += chars[bytes[i]! % chars.length]; } return `NESSH-${code}`; } export namespace PairingCode { export const Info = z .object({ id: z.string().meta({ description: 'Unique identifier for the pairing code record', example: Examples.PairingCode.id }), code: z.string().meta({ description: 'Human-readable pairing code (e.g. NESSH-7F2Q)', example: Examples.PairingCode.code }), targetUserId: z.string().meta({ description: 'The user who generated this code', example: Examples.PairingCode.targetUserId }), newFingerprint: z.string().optional().nullable().meta({ description: 'The fingerprint that was paired (set on claim)', example: Examples.PairingCode.newFingerprint }), expiresAt: z.iso.datetime().meta({ description: 'When this code expires', example: Examples.PairingCode.expiresAt }), claimedAt: z.iso.datetime().optional().nullable().meta({ description: 'When this code was claimed', example: Examples.PairingCode.claimedAt }), isClaimed: z.boolean().meta({ description: 'Whether this code has been used', example: Examples.PairingCode.isClaimed }) }) .meta({ ref: 'PairingCode', description: 'Ephemeral device pairing code for linking a new SSH key to an existing user', example: Examples.PairingCode }); export type Info = z.infer; export const create = fn( Info.pick({ id: true, targetUserId: true }).extend({ ttlMinutes: z.number().default(10) }), async (input) => { const code = generateCode(); await Database.use(async (tx) => { await tx.insert(PairingCodeTable).values({ id: input.id, code, targetUserId: input.targetUserId, expiresAt: sql`now() + interval '${sql.raw(String(input.ttlMinutes))} minutes'`, isClaimed: false, newFingerprint: null, claimedAt: null }); }); return code; } ); export const claim = fn( Info.pick({ code: true }).extend({ fingerprint: z.string() }), async (input) => { return Database.use(async (tx) => { const row = await tx .select() .from(PairingCodeTable) .where( and( eq(PairingCodeTable.code, input.code), eq(PairingCodeTable.isClaimed, false), gt(PairingCodeTable.expiresAt, sql`now()`), isNull(PairingCodeTable.timeDeleted) ) ) .then((rows) => rows.at(0) ?? null); if (!row) { return null; } // `.returning()` rather than handing back the row read before // the update: that row still says `isClaimed: false`, so a // caller inspecting it would see a code that is not yet used. return tx .update(PairingCodeTable) .set({ isClaimed: true, newFingerprint: input.fingerprint, claimedAt: sql`now()` }) .where(eq(PairingCodeTable.id, row.id)) .returning() .then((rows) => { const claimed = rows.at(0); return claimed ? serialize(claimed) : null; }); }); } ); export const listByUser = fn(Info.shape.targetUserId, async (targetUserId) => { return Database.use(async (tx) => { return tx .select() .from(PairingCodeTable) .where( and(eq(PairingCodeTable.targetUserId, targetUserId), isNull(PairingCodeTable.timeDeleted)) ) .orderBy(PairingCodeTable.timeCreated); }); }); export const remove = fn(Info.shape.id, async (id) => { await Database.use(async (tx) => { await tx .update(PairingCodeTable) .set({ timeDeleted: sql`now()` }) .where(eq(PairingCodeTable.id, id)); }); }); export function serialize(input: typeof PairingCodeTable.$inferSelect): z.infer { return { id: input.id, code: input.code, targetUserId: input.targetUserId, newFingerprint: input.newFingerprint, expiresAt: input.expiresAt.toISOString(), claimedAt: input.claimedAt?.toISOString() ?? null, isClaimed: input.isClaimed }; } }
